Typical Day-to-Day Responsibilities
As a Kitchen Helper Cleaner, your main duties include supporting the kitchen staff with daily preparations and ensuring the cleanliness of kitchen areas. You will be expected to maintain hygiene and sanitation standards throughout the kitchen. Preparing basic ingredients and assisting with meal service are also part of the daily routine. Cleaning up after meal prep and ensuring all kitchen equipment is properly stored will round out your tasks. Teamwork and punctuality are important qualities that will help you excel in this position.
